Bette Midler set to perform at the 91st Academy Awards

The veteran singer will perform 'The Place Where Lost Things Go' from Mary Poppins Returns at the awards ceremony

Bette Midler has announced that she will be performing at the upcoming 91st Academy Awards. She is set to perform 'The Place Where Lost Things Go' from Mary Poppins Returns at the awards ceremony.

"So, (drum roll) Ladies and Gentlemen, I will be chanteusing (that's singing) on the Oscars on Feb 24...the nominated song from 'Mary Poppins'... 'The Place Where Lost Things Go' ...so excited!!" the 73-year-old wrote on Twitter. The song, written by Marc Shaiman and Scott Wittman, was originally performed by actor Emily Blunt in the 2018 film.
